我在 JavaScript 脚本中应用了以下教程:http: //www.html5canvastutorials.com/labs/html5-canvas-interactive-building-map/
在大多数情况下,它就像一个魅力。每当我滚动整个网站时,一切都很顺利,将鼠标悬停在形状上效果很好。
但是,每当我在网站内创建一个可滚动的 div 时,其中的形状都会与图片一起保持在原位(可见形状是指您实际看到的),但是每当我悬停时,我都必须每当我向下滚动时,将鼠标悬停在下方,如下所示:
http://i45.tinypic.com/28cn7ur.png (注意滚动条的位置和我的鼠标相对于它上面蓝色形状的位置)
中心的 div 是相对定位的,在这个 div 中我有一个画布包装 div(也是相对位置),其中有画布本身。
是什么导致了这个问题?